ARF triggers senescence in Brca2-deficient cells by altering the spectrum of p53 transcriptional targets.
Nature communications - 1 Jan 2013
Carlos Ana Rita, Escandell Jose Miguel, Kotsantis Panagiotis, Suwaki Natsuko, Bouwman Peter, Badie Sophie, Folio Cecilia, Benitez Javier, Gomez-Lopez Gonzalo, Pisano David G, Jonkers Jos, Tarsounas Madalena
Abstract excerpt
ARF is a tumour suppressor activated by oncogenic stress, which stabilizes p53. Although p53 is a key component of the response to DNA damage, a similar function for ARF has not been ascribed.
